Action item: The Relayn deploy-status bot silently dropped updates when the pipeline API paginated results, so responders believed a rollback had completed when it had not. We will add pagination handling, a staleness banner, and an integration test. Until merged, verify deploy state directly in the pipeline console, documented at the page below.

runbook for kahop-kajop: https://rundeck.ordinio.test/display/secrets/pipeline/issue/pages/repo/browse/e5732776e07d1285107e5aeb

## Deployment

Meterbill workers use blue-green. Green receives shadow traffic for ten minutes; if invoice totals match blue, the switch flips. Support: during a flip, customers may see a brief "processing" state — no charges duplicate. Do not escalate unless the state persists past fifteen minutes. The active deployment configuration is shown below.

deployment values, yadug-bawif:
[framir]
team = pelox
access_code = ac_a38ab2
owner = tamion.julael
host = framir.tolvaqlabs.test
port = 11211
peer = tammir.zemvargrid.local
salt = 2215ef03
pin = 1541

## Runbook: Slimmed Images (Bracken)

As of release 14, Bracken containers use the slim base. Debug tools (curl, strace, shell utilities) are gone. For diagnostics, attach the sidecar toolbox image instead of exec'ing into the main container. If a customer reports missing binaries post-upgrade, it's expected — point them to the toolbox doc. Image size dropped from 1.1 GB to 180 MB; startup is faster. The slim build ships with these runtime settings.

settings of fafog-haduf:
ZORIX_PIN=4648
ZORIX_METRICS_HOST=metrics.zorix.paliqsys.corp
ZORIX_LOG_LEVEL=info
ZORIX_TENANT=druix

TURN-208: Gatevale turnstile counters at the Merrow Field pilot double-count when a rotation reverses mid-cycle. Attendance totals drift roughly 2% high per event. The debounce window fix is implemented, reviewed by Ilsa, and soak-tested across two simulated match days without drift. Ready for your cut; the candidate build is identified below.

trace token, tagag-tafog: htk6_5ed18c